AI agents invoke connect-jump-host-serverless-cache to trigger actions in Awslabs Valkey. What it does depends on the arguments the agent supplies, and its effects often reach beyond the immediate call — builds kicked off, notifications sent, workflows started.
The name suggests establishing a network connection via a jump host to a serverless cache (likely ElastiCache/MemoryDB). This implies executing an external operation (SSH tunneling or network proxying) to establish connectivity.

Yes. Add a rate_limit block to the connect-jump-host-serverless-cache r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for connect-jump-host-serverless-cache.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
